#cf7e69 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cf7e69 is composed of 81.2% red, 49.4%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 39.1% magenta, 49.3%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 12.4 degrees, a saturation of 51.5% and a lightness of 61.2%. #cf7e69 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ffcd2 with #9f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#cf7e69 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#cf7e69 has RGB values of R:207, G:126,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.39, Y:0.49,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 13598313.

Hex triplet cf7e69 #cf7e69
RGB Decimal 207, 126, 105 rgb(207,126,105)
RGB Percent 81.2, 49.4, 41.2 rgb(81.2%,49.4%,41.2%)
CMYK 0, 39, 49, 19
HSL 12.4°, 51.5, 61.2 hsl(12.4,51.5%,61.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 12.4°, 49.3, 81.2
Web Safe cc6666 #cc6666
CIE-LAB 60.966, 29.152, 24.754
XYZ 35.743, 29.209, 17.119
xyY 0.436, 0.356, 29.209
CIE-LCH 60.966, 38.244, 40.336
CIE-LUV 60.966, 58.938, 25.493
Hunter-Lab 54.046, 23.471, 19.052
Binary 11001111, 01111110, 01101001

Shades and Tints of #cf7e69

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0604 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#cf7e69

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a19997 is the less saturated color, while #fd633b is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#cf7e69 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#949494 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#a0908b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#a29878 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#b4926d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#d38189 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#b28e73 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#be8b6b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#d17f7d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
